Falcons Win Kitsap Series

July 2, 2015 - West Coast League (WCL)
Kelowna Falcons News Release


Kitsap County, WA - What a difference 24 hours makes. The Kelowna Falcons went from 3 base hits to 12, and 1 run to 11 runs as they knocked off the Kitsap BlueJackets 11-2 Wednesday at Gene Lobe Field.

The Falcons scored in 6 of the 9 innings, including the 1st, when Justin Flores picked up his 1st of 3 RBI's in the contest.

The BlueJackets responded with one in the bottom half against starter Joel Lamont, but he settled down, working 6 innings, giving up 3 hits and striking out 7.

Kelowna added a pair of runs in the 2nd on RBI's from Andre Jackson and JJ Muno, before scoring 2 more in the 4th.

Flores had a 2-RBI single with 2 outs in the inning, after Jackson and Muno executed a double-steal.

The 5th inning was a strange one. Kelowna scored 4 runs in the frame on only 1 hit. They drew 3 walks, were hit by a pitch, and took advantage of 3 balks, an error, and a wild pitch to open up a 9-1 lead.

They would tack on runs in the 6th and 7th, as Josh Egan and Dalton Blackwell got into the RBI act.

Wade Gulden went 2-4 and Grant Meylan had a pair of hits off the bench as well.

Kitsap scored their 2nd run in the 8th off Matt Kirk, but that;s as close as it would come.

With the win, the Falcons move back into 1st place in the West Coast League East Division, a dance with Yakima Valley that could become even more common as the season progresses. The Falcons will not face the Pippins again, so no direct games affect the standings between those two teams.
